コード例 #1
0
        public List <User> getUserByUserName(string username)
        {
            MemberShip  member   = new MemberShip();
            List <User> userlist = new List <User>();
            User        user     = null;
            var         q        = from c in db.User where c.name.Contains(username) select c;

            foreach (var a in q)
            {
                user             = new User();
                user.userid      = a.userid;
                user.tip         = a.tip;
                user.phone       = a.phone;
                user.paypassword = a.paypassword;
                user.password    = a.password;
                user.name        = a.name;
                user.instruction = a.instruction;
                user.image       = a.image;
                userlist.Add(user);
            }

            return(userlist);
        }
コード例 #2
0
        public List <Blog> getBlogByUsername(string username)
        {
            MemberShip  member   = new MemberShip();
            List <Blog> bloglist = new List <Blog>();
            Blog        blog     = null;
            int         userid   = member.getUserIdByName(username);
            var         q        = from c in db.Blog where c.userid == userid select c;

            foreach (var a in q)
            {
                blog            = new Blog();
                blog.userid     = a.userid;
                blog.blogid     = a.blogid;
                blog.category   = a.category;
                blog.content    = a.content;
                blog.title      = a.title;
                blog.updatetime = a.updatetime;
                blog.userid     = a.userid;
                blog.costnum    = a.costnum;
                bloglist.Add(blog);
            }

            return(bloglist);
        }